Historically, all hairdressers were taken into consideration barbers. In the 20th century, the profession of cosmetology branched off from barbering, and today stylists may be accredited as either barbers or cosmetologists. Barbers vary with regard to where they function, which solutions they are accredited to supply, and what name they use to describe themselves.
In the very early 1900s, an alternative word for barber, "chirotonsor", entered into use in the U.S. Various states in the US differ on their labor and licensing regulations. In Maryland and Pennsylvania, a cosmetologist can not use a straight razor, purely reserved for barbers. On the other hand, in New Jersey both are regulated by the State Board of Cosmetology and there is no longer a legal distinction in barbers and cosmetologists, as they are provided the same certificate and can practice both the art of straight razor shaving, tinting, other chemical work and haircutting if they pick. [] In Australia, throughout the mid to late 20th century, the official term for a barber was guys's beautician; barber was only a prominent title for men's stylists.
In ancient Egyptian culture, barbers were highly respected individuals. Priests and guys of medicine are the earliest recorded instances of barbers.

The white and red stripes represent plasters and blood while heaven red stripes stand for veins. The post might be fixed or might turn, often with the aid of an electrical motor. A spinning barber pole produces a aesthetic impression, in which the stripes seem traveling up or down the length of the pole, instead than around it.
